What is a single cell core?

A Single Cell Core is a specialized facility within a research institution that provides expertise, equipment, and services for single-cell genomics and related technologies. These cores support researchers in isolating, processing, and analyzing individual cells to better understand cellular heterogeneity in complex tissues. Services may include single-cell RNA sequencing, library preparation, data analysis, and consultation. Single Cell Cores are essential for advancing research in fields such as cancer biology, immunology, and developmental biology.

What are the key skills and qualifications needed to thrive as a single cell core specialist?

To thrive as a Single Cell Core specialist, you need a strong background in molecular biology, genomics, and experience with single-cell sequencing techniques, often supported by an advanced degree in a life science field. Familiarity with technical tools such as flow cytometry, next-generation sequencing platforms, and data analysis software like Seurat or Cell Ranger is essential. Strong problem-solving abilities, attention to detail, and effective communication are key soft skills for collaborating with researchers and ensuring high-quality results. These competencies are crucial for generating reliable data, facilitating cutting-edge research, and advancing scientific discoveries in the field.

What are some common challenges faced by professionals working in a single cell core facility, and how can new team members prepare for them?

Professionals in a Single Cell Core facility often encounter challenges such as troubleshooting complex instrumentation, managing large volumes of high-dimensional data, and ensuring sample quality throughout the workflow. New team members can prepare by developing strong technical skills in single cell platforms (like 10x Genomics or Fluidigm), familiarizing themselves with bioinformatics tools, and cultivating effective communication with researchers to understand experiment goals. Working collaboratively within a multidisciplinary team and staying current with emerging single cell technologies will also help overcome these challenges and contribute to the core’s success.

The Sahoo Lab is seeking a motivated Postdoctoral Associate to study the genetic and functional mechanisms driving inherited bone marrow failure and predisposition to MDS/AML. This NIH-funded position focuses on defining how germline gain-of-function mutations activate chronic inflammatory signaling, impair hematopoietic stem cell function, and drive progression to myeloid malignancy. The project integrates mouse and iPSC models, CRISPR genome editing, molecular biology, flow cytometry, and single-cell multi-omics to dissect disease mechanisms.

We are committed to mentoring the whole scientist. The successful candidate will lead this project while growing toward research independence, supported by an individualized development plan, structured mentorship, and clear milestones tailored to their career goals. Postdocs are actively mentored to publish, present, build collaborations, and compete for fellowships and career-development awards (e.g., NIH F32, K99/R00). The position is funded for up to three years, with full access to Virginia Tech and Children's National Hospital core facilities and seminars. The candidate will also have the opportunity to mentor and train junior scientists, developing the leadership and mentoring skills essential to an independent career. This is an exciting opportunity to play a foundational role in a growing lab at the Research and Innovation Campus in Washington, DC.

About Virginia Tech

Sourced by ZipRecruiter

Virginia Tech, guided by its motto "Ut Prosim" (That I May Serve), embraces a hands-on, interdisciplinary approach to educate scholars as leaders and problem-solvers. As a comprehensive land-grant institution, it enriches the quality of life in Virginia and worldwide, fostering an inclusive community focused on knowledge, discovery, and creativity. With over 280 majors, the university serves a diverse student body of more than 36,000 across undergraduate, graduate, and professional programs. Virginia Tech's presence extends throughout Virginia, including campuses in Northern Virginia, Roanoke, Newport News, and Richmond, along with multiple Extension offices and research centers. As a prominent global research institution, it conducts over $500 million in research annually.
